John Luke Hill Jr. (October 9, 1923 – July 9, 2007) was an American lawyer, politician, and judge who served as the chief justice of the Texas Supreme Court from 1985 to 1988. A member of the Democratic Party, he served as the 69th secretary of state of Texas from 1966 to 1968 and the 45th attorney general of Texas from 1973 to 1979. Hill is the only person to have held all three offices.
